Populaire 12A
With an eye-popping visual style and dazzling costumes, Populaire is a chic and sumptuous romantic comedy, sparkling with vintage Hollywood charm.
Set in 1950s France, Populaire is the extraordinary tale of Rose (Deborah Francois), a village shopkeeper’s daughter who travels to Normandy to try out for a job as a secretary for local lawyer, and bachelor, Louis (Romain Duris).
Lacking the grace necessary to perform the role, Rose’s interview is a disaster but reveals a special gift – she is a speed demon on the typewriter!
Louis’ competitive spirit is reawakened and he hires Rose and begins an intensive training regime to prepare her to compete in the country’s cut-throat and high profile typing contests.
